NAS 2014 Courses at ICUAIn 2014 ICUA Zadar will continue to organize Nautical Archaeological Society (NAS) courses. NAS courses aim to provide not just an introduction to the underwater archaeology, but also offer people a chance to build their skills and experience, allowing them to take part in projects and fieldwork around the world and perhaps to run their own projects. The ICUA Team will conduct NAS courses during 2014 in Veštar bay close to Rovinj. Courses requirements Note that it is not necessary to have attended an Introductory or Part I course prior to attending Part II or Part III courses; however credit points will only be awarded to those who have completed the Introductory Course.
